UPI, or Unified Payments Interface, has emerged as a game-changer in the realm for digital payments. With its intuitive interface and instantaneous processing speeds, UPI supports secure and effective money transactions. Its growing adoption in India underscores its potential to revolutionize the way we conduct payments. As technology progresses, UPI is poised to shape the future of digital trade.

Transforming India's Financial Landscape
The Unified Payments Interface (UPI) has emerged as a powerful tool in India's digital transformation journey. It provides a convenient platform for instantaneous fund transfers, modernizing the way Indians manage their finances. UPI's accessibility and adaptability have enabled millions of users across the country to engage in the digital economy.
This innovative system has promoted financial inclusion by bridging even the most remote areas.
Through UPI, Indians can now effortlessly use a wide range of payment options, such as mobile recharges, bill payments, and online shopping. The expansion of UPI is rapidly growing, highlighting its substantial impact on India's financial landscape.
